Tacey and Horses
Tacey rode her first horse the week after she lost her sight. It was an instant new love! Tacey started riding horses any chance she got. She is very relaxed and comfortable in the saddle. In fact, at times she is a little too comfortable and wants more speed and spirit from her horse. This no fear attitude led her to want to start learning barrel racing.
The race was on for us to find the right horse. Most people cringed in fear at the thought of this small, blind child barrel racing! We knew with the right horse she could be a success.
God had started on this plan 14 years earlier when a very special thoroughbred was born, Hope Runs Deep. Hope ran 2 races on the track and came in last in both races. This ended his track racing career but started his barrel racing career. He was a champion barrel racer and was Tacey's ticket to to the rodeo scene.
Hope was only in our lives for one year, but made a significant impact on each of us. God sent him to be Tacey's special guardian. Now that Tacey is ready to move on to Western Pleasure, we are confident God will again send Tacey the perfect companion, guardian and friend!
